Transaction 34353abad9ab198530cf657034078cbcff512da95db281f104ddd88540304d75
1 Input
2 Outputs
- 34353abad9ab198530cf657034078cbcff512da95db281f104ddd88540304d75:0
- 34353abad9ab198530cf657034078cbcff512da95db281f104ddd88540304d75:1
value 50000000
address 1JUVru45pWFtyiTQfNAUxyMPLudJUvEftj
value 938636268
address 1LsiUDebX3XxaY9crSYNpXWiMER37KgKXL